Description

Ground Investigation (GI) works at Lower Tinnahinch Weir And Rock Fish Pass comprises the following: • Cable percussion to maximum depth of 10m BGL • Insitu SPT N testing in all boreholes. • Insitu permeability testing in selected boreholes where ground conditions allow. • Trial pits to 3m BGL or effective refusal. • Geophysical Surveying • Grab samples • In-situ and laboratory geotechnical testing. • Laboratory environmental testing. • Standard re-instatement of works for all locations. The investigations are distributed throughout the Tinnahinch Weir And Fish Pass. Refer to the tender documents for more details.
